Coda AI Overview
Coda AI is an innovative productivity tool that stands out in the crowded landscape of project management and collaboration software. By merging the functionalities of documents, spreadsheets, and interactive apps, Coda provides a comprehensive solution for users ranging from individual freelancers to large teams. One of its key strengths is the ability to create customized workflows tailored to specific project needs, allowing users to design everything from simple to-do lists to complex project management systems without requiring extensive technical knowledge. The platform's pricing model is appealing, especially for small businesses and startups. The free tier offers substantial functionality, allowing users to explore the platform's capabilities without any financial commitment. For those who require more advanced features, the Pro version at $10 per month is competitively priced compared to alternatives like Notion or Airtable, which often charge higher fees for similar functionalities. Coda's features are particularly noteworthy. Users can create rich documents that integrate various media formats, making it easy to present information in an engaging way. The interactive tables and databases allow for dynamic data management, enabling users to track and manipulate information efficiently. Additionally, automation capabilities help reduce manual tasks, which can be a game-changer for teams looking to optimize their workflows. Collaboration is at the heart of Coda AI, with real-time editing and feedback tools that facilitate seamless teamwork. This is particularly beneficial for remote teams, as it enables multiple users to contribute simultaneously, reducing the time spent on revisions and approvals. Coda also offers a library of templates that can be used to kickstart projects quickly, saving users time on setup. However, Coda is not without its drawbacks. Some advanced features may require a bit of a learning curve, particularly for users who are not familiar with similar tools. Additionally, while the platform is primarily cloud-based, its offline capabilities are limited, which can be a concern for users who need access to their documents without internet connectivity. Lastly, while Coda integrates with several third-party tools, the process can sometimes be less intuitive than expected, which may hinder some users from fully leveraging its capabilities. Raycast AI represents a significant leap forward in productivity tools, offering Mac users an intelligent and streamlined workflow enhancement. The application's core strength lies in its seamless integration of artificial intelligence directly into the desktop experience. Users can leverage AI capabilities for complex tasks like code generation, text transformation, and rapid information retrieval without leaving their current workspace. The tool's intuitive interface makes advanced AI functionalities feel natural and accessible, reducing cognitive friction typically associated with AI interactions. Its ability to generate code snippets, draft emails, and provide contextual suggestions makes it an invaluable companion for professionals across various domains. While the Pro version requires a monthly subscription, the depth of functionality and time-saving potential justify the investment for serious productivity enthusiasts. The privacy-first approach and tight macOS integration further distinguish Raycast AI from comparable tools. Power users will appreciate the extensive customization options and the ability to create personalized AI workflows. However, potential users should be aware of the platform limitations, as the tool is currently exclusive to macOS.
